ANZTBCRS Regulations and Policies

Post Fellowship Training in colorectal surgery is a two-year course following completion of advanced training in general surgery and success at the Part II FRACS examination.

Details of the program structure and requirements are outlined in the ANZTBCRS Regulations and Policies document.

Overseas Training

Fellows considering an overseas training year must review the Overseas Training Policy to ensure they meet the ANZTBCRS requirements and submit the required documentation as part of their application.

Fellows proposing an overseas placement must submit an Overseas Hospital Training Unit Profile, along with supporting documentation, no later than 31 May of the year prior to the placement.

Required for submission by 31 May

  • Completed Overseas Hospital Training Unit Profile Form
  • Application letter from the Training Fellow (reasons for the placement, learning goals, and benefit to long-term practice)
  • Signed letter of appointment / agreement to appoint, including planned start and finish dates
  • Training Fellow's detailed weekly schedule of duties
  • Operative logbook of the previous Training Fellow, covering a minimum of 12 months
